Mount Baseball and Niagara Face Off in Emmitsburg for MAAC Series Starting on Friday

EMMITSBURG, Md. (March 20, 2025) – Mount St. Mary's baseball comes home to Emmitsburg after a four game road trip to New York and Washington D.C. to face of against Niagara in a three-game Metro Atlantic Athletic Conference series. After their midweek game against George Washington, the Mount is now 8-11 overall with a 2-4 record in the MAAC.

MOUNT UPDATE

Against the Revolutionaries, the Mountaineers found themselves down in the first three innings by a score of 1-0 even though starter, Owen Crowe, went 5.0 innings and striking out four Revolutionaries in his innings of work. Bryce Rudisill once again proved his power at the plate in the top of the fourth after a ball sent out to right field hit off the score board to drive in Ethan Flaugher and Sam Grube for a three-run home run. A three-run home run for the home side in the bottom of the sixth regained the lead for GW however, even in the face of good pitching.

 Two more runs for the Revolutionaries came in the bottom of the eight to up their score to 6-3. In the top of the ninth, Jake Maske ground out to the short stop while Nolan Book scored in the process. Ty Fredo singled through the left side of the infield later on in the inning, scoring Mikey Rodriguez. But George Washington worked the Mount batters into a double play, ending the scoring drive and the game in the ninth.

Fredo had a nearly perfect day at the plate, going 4-5 and knocking in a RBI to up his season batting average to .378. Book went 2-3 from the plate with a double and a hit by pitch while scoring a RBI in the process. And Grube went 1-4 on the day with a early innings double to set the tone for the rest of the offense.

SCOUTING THE PURPLE EAGLES

Niagara has an overall record of 3-13 with a MAAC Record of 0-3, getting swept by Marist in their opening series on the weekend of March 14. The Purple Eagles have faced off against tough competition in Miami, Purdue, and Valparaiso, while beating Beacons 11-1 in their first game of the series.

Nate Milk has recorded a .328 with a OPS of .922 along with 32 total bases and eight RBIs. Jacob Brooks has also recorded a OPS of .762 with a batting average of .298, seven RBIs and 19 total bases. Matthew DelVeecchio leads the Purple Eagle's pitching staff among qualified starters with a 6.35 ERA and 7 strikeouts.

ALL-TIME SERIES

The Mountaineers are 0-7 against the Purple Eagles, with the losing streak dating back to their first match up on May 18, 2023.
